五味子为临床常用中药之一,其富含多种化学成分,包括木脂素类、挥发油类、多糖、有机酸、萜类、黄酮类等化学成分,药用价值极高,在临床上可用于治疗心悸失眠、自汗盗汗、内热消渴、津伤口渴、久咳虚喘、尿频遗尿、梦遗滑精、久泻不止等病证。现代药理研究发现五味子在中枢神经系统方面具有镇静催眠、健脑益智、镇痛、抗惊厥和抗抑郁的作用,在消化系统方面可调节胃肠道蠕动、保肝护肝,在免疫系统方面发挥抗肿瘤和抗人类免疫缺陷病毒(HIV)的作用,同时具有保护心血管,降血糖,保肺护肾,促进生殖,抗菌抑菌,抗高泌乳血症、抗骨质疏松及对胚胎损伤和视网膜的保护作用等。该文对近年来国内外有关五味子临床药理作用的研究进行归纳总结,为五味子后续深入研究提供思路,为其合理开发利用提供理论依据,并在临床疾病治疗方面具有重大指导意义。
Schisandrae Chinensis Fructus (SCF), a commonly used clinical Chinese medicine, is rich in chemical components, including lignans, volatile oils, polysaccharides, organic acids, terpenoids, and flavonoids. It has a high medicinal value, which is manifested in the treatment of palpitation, insomnia, spontaneous perspiration, internal heat, consumptive thirst, fluid injury, chronic cough, asthma, frequent urination, enuresis, nocturnal emission, chronic diarrhea, etc. Modern pharmacological studies have found that SCF has sedative, hypnotic, brain invigorating, analgesic, anticonvulsant, and antidepressant effects in the central nervous system. In the digestive system, it can regulate gastrointestinal motility and protect the liver. In the immune system, it is effective in resisting tumors and human immunodeficiency virus (HIV), and also potent in protecting the cardiovascular system, lung and kidney, reducing blood sugar, promoting reproduction, inhibiting bacteria, resisting hyperprolactinemia and osteoporosis, and protecting against embryo damage and retina injury. This study reviewed the available research on clinical pharmacological effects of SCF in recent years and provided ideas for further research on
SCF and theoretical basis for its rational development and utilization, which was of great guiding significance in clinical disease treatment.
